The shoe shields could be the issue. Did you fit the plastic spacer under the cleat, on top of the shoe shield?
When I used CB on a pair of Shimano trekking shoes they didn’t need the plastic spacer. But the sole of the shoe was a bit worn. Some new Giro shoes, so I fitted shoe shields to save the sole, but had to faff with the spacers, and had to trim them to the same profile as the cleats to get the wings of the pedals to clip over the cleat properly. I then had horrible hot spots because the shoes were floating above the cage of the Candy pedals and offered no support.
